Breaking Down the Features of Labnet Elastic Tie Downs, Pack Of 4 S2025-T
Specifications
- Designed for Labnet equipment: Specifically made for the Labnet GyroTwister GX-1000 3-D Shaker and Labnet ProBlot 25 and 25XL Rockers. This ensures optimal compatibility and secure fit.
- Elastic construction: Made from durable elastic material. The material is engineered to maintain elasticity over repeated use.
- Pack of 4: Comes with four tie-downs per pack. Providing multiple tie-downs ensures redundancy and the ability to secure multiple items simultaneously.

Who Should Buy Labnet Elastic Tie Downs, Pack Of 4 S2025-T?
These tie-downs are perfect for laboratory professionals and researchers who use Labnet GyroTwister GX-1000 3-D Shakers or Labnet ProBlot 25 and 25XL Rockers. They are also useful for any lab worker who values stability, security, and ease of use in securing lab equipment.
Anyone looking for a general-purpose tie-down solution should probably skip this product. Generic bungee cords or adjustable straps will likely offer more versatility at a lower cost. A user might also consider finding a customizable 3rd party tie-down.
